Coupled with this are the workshops. Bit BUYITALY will run on the 19th and 20th of February and Bit BUY CLUB will run on the 18th February.
Bit offers more than 5,000 companies from 130 countries at its conference. It offers professionals attending as guests the chance to be updated on the latest market trends, as well as a full calendar of events and training sessions.
Travel agents and international pre-registered operators can attend the conference free of charge. However, for others, the prices vary by day.
A four-day badge for professionals is €22 during the advanced sale and €30 afterward. For two days, attendees will pay €14 in advance or €18 on the day. Daily passes can be purchased for €9 in advance or €12 on the day.
For the public a one-day pre-registered pass is €10 in advance or €12 on the day.
